Last updated: 2024 Jun 14Morning
Start your day by visiting the Sunny Jim Sea Cave , a unique sea cave accessible by land in La Jolla Cove. Then, head to Mt. Soledad National Veterans Memorial for breathtaking views of San Diego and to pay tribute to the veterans who served in the United States Armed Forces.
Afternoon
Visit Children's Pool Beach , a small beach in La Jolla that is home to a colony of harbor seals. Then, head to Birch Aquarium at Scripps , which features a variety of marine life exhibits and interactive displays.
Morning
Start your day with a round of golf at Torrey Pines Golf Course , which offers stunning views of the Pacific Ocean and the Torrey Pines State Natural Reserve . Then, head to Windansea Beach , a popular surfing spot that is known for its beautiful scenery and clear water.
Afternoon
Visit the Salk Institute , a research facility that was founded by Jonas Salk, the creator of the polio vaccine. Then, head to the San Diego Zoo Safari Park , which features a variety of exotic animals and offers a unique safari experience.
Morning
Start your day by visiting the USS Midway Museum , a retired aircraft carrier that is now a museum. Then, head to Coronado , a beautiful island that is home to the historic Hotel del Coronado and a variety of shops and restaurants.
Afternoon
Spend the afternoon at Balboa Park , a 1,200-acre park in the heart of San Diego that is home to 17 museums, several gardens, and the San Diego Zoo .
Morning
Start your day by visiting Petco Park , a state-of-the-art baseball stadium that is home to the San Diego Padres. Then, head to the Maritime Museum of San Diego , which features a collection of historic ships and exhibits on maritime history.
Afternoon
Visit Seaport Village , a waterfront shopping and dining complex that offers stunning views of the San Diego Bay. Then, head to Cabrillo National Monument , which offers stunning views of the Pacific Ocean and the San Diego skyline.
Morning
Start your day by visiting the San Diego Air & Space Museum , which features a variety of exhibits on aviation and space travel. Then, head to Old Town San Diego , a historic district that is home to several museums and a variety of shops and restaurants.
Afternoon
Take a stroll through El Prado , a pedestrian walkway in Balboa Park that is lined with museums and gardens. Then, head to the San Diego Harbor , where you can take a harbor tour and learn about the history of San Diego's waterfront.
Morning
Start your day by visiting the Embarcadero , a waterfront promenade that is home to several museums and a variety of shops and restaurants. Then, head to Ocean Beach Pier , which offers stunning views of the Pacific Ocean and the San Diego skyline.
Afternoon
Visit the Japanese Friendship Garden , a beautiful garden in Balboa Park that is designed to promote friendship and understanding between Japan and the United States. Then, head to Belmont Park , an amusement park that features a variety of rides and attractions.
